Watermelon Mojito Smoothie

Ingredients

  • Watermelon (7-8 frozen cubes)– Check out this post to learn how to make watermelon ice cubes! 
  • Mint (4-5 leaves)
  • Strawberry (1/2 cup)
  • 1 Lime (squeezed)
  • Almond Milk (1 cup)
  • Greek Yogurt (1/2 cup)
  • Honey (2 Tablespoons)
  • Ice cube tray
  • Blender

Directions

  1. In a blender place fresh watermelon and blend until smooth. Pour watermelon puree into ice cube trays and freeze
  2. Place strawberries, mint, watermelon cubes, and lime in the blender. Then add almond milk, greek yogurt, and honey. 
  3. Add extra water, almond milk, or watermelon puree until desired thickness is achieved.
  4. Blend until desired consistency and enjoy!
Calorie Information: ~360 calories, 5g fat (if using full fat Greek yogurt), 65g carbohydrates, and 15g protein
Note: These are all approximated values and are not intended to be the focus of any healthy lifestyle choices.
Green Goddess Smoothie

Ingredients

  • Dandelion (1/4 cup)
  • Swiss chard (1/2 cup)
  • Mixed Greens (1/2 cup)
  • 1 frozen ripe bananas
  • Kiwi (1-2 Kiwi’s)
  • Almond milk (1.5 cup)
  • Spirulina (2 teaspoons)
  • Vanilla protein powder (2 Scoops)
  • Blender

Directions

  1. In a blender place greens, kiwi, and frozen bananas. Then add almond milk, spirulina, and protein powder.
  2. Add extra water or almond milk until desired thickness is achieved.
  3. Blend until desired consistency and enjoy!
Calorie Information: ~300 calories, 2g fat, 60g carbohydrate, and 24g protein 
Note: These are all approximated values and are not intended to be the focus of any healthy lifestyle choices.

Simply Sunshine Smoothie

Ingredients

  • Frozen peaches (1/2 cup)
  • Frozen mango (1/2 cup)
  • Spinach or other leafy greens (1/2 handful)
  • Flaxseed (2 teaspoons)
  • Full fat coconut milk (1/2 cup)
  • Almond Milk (1.5 cups)
  • Vanilla protein powder (2 scoops)
  • Blender

Directions

  1. Place all ingredient in a blender.
  2. Add extra water or almond milk until desired thickness is achieved.
  3. Blend until desired consistency and enjoy!
Calorie Information: ~349 calories, 5g fat, 60g carbohydrate, and 24g protein
Note: These are all approximated values and are not intended to be the focus of any healthy lifestyle choices.
